]> git.ipfire.org Git - thirdparty/curl.git/commitdiff
CI/distcheck: run full tests
authorDaniel Stenberg <daniel@haxx.se>
Mon, 11 Dec 2023 17:57:48 +0000 (18:57 +0100)
committerDaniel Stenberg <daniel@haxx.se>
Mon, 11 Dec 2023 22:26:04 +0000 (23:26 +0100)
To be able to detect missing files better, this now runs the full CI
test suite. If done before, it would have detected #12462 before
release.

Closes #12503

.github/workflows/distcheck.yml

index 8b908e0a5bc631759c829dccf32910a1c2e84d7a..6c050f517407ff14190dfdc485e02c16b558c606 100644 (file)
@@ -50,7 +50,7 @@ jobs:
           pushd curl-99.98.97
           ./configure --prefix=$HOME/temp --without-ssl
           make
-          make TFLAGS=1 test
+          make test-ci
           make install
           popd
           # basic check of the installed files
@@ -75,7 +75,7 @@ jobs:
           pushd build
           ../curl-99.98.97/configure --without-ssl
           make
-          make TFLAGS='-p 1 1139' test
+          make test-ci
           popd
           rm -rf build
           rm -rf curl-99.98.97
@@ -98,7 +98,7 @@ jobs:
           pushd build
           ../configure --without-ssl --enable-debug "--prefix=${PWD}/pkg"
           make -j3
-          make -j3 TFLAGS=1279 test
+          make -j3 test-ci
           make -j3 install
         name: 'verify out-of-tree autotools debug build'